Refined by:

Clear all
42 products

Availability

Availability

Price

The highest price is £66.38
£
To
£
Filter and sort Filter

Filter and sort

Filter

Refined by: Clear all

42 results

Availability
Price

The highest price is £66.38

£
To
£
View as
Items per page
24
Sort by:
Best selling

Isha Life

Showing 1 -24of 42 products